MEDIA 270 - Economics of Emerging Technology

Institution:
Bellevue College
Subject:
Media Communication & Technology
Description:
Investigates the causes and effects of technological innovation in a modern economy. Students examine the information technology industries, particularly the roles of government and the private sector. Topics may include economic globalization, effects on labor markets, ownership of information, and antitrust laws as applied to new industries. Same as ECON 270. Either MEDIA 270 or ECON 270 may be taken for credit, not both. Prerequisite: ECON& 201 (prev ECON 201).
